CardiTraining Programs

Development happens daily. Coaching should too.

Online training

CardiTraining Player Portal Access

Open to athletes located anywhere — daily coaching, video review, and feedback delivered entirely through the Player Portal.

Train with intention

  • Daily coach-guided programming
  • Structured routines built around long-term development
  • Clear progression from week to week

Learn how to adjust

  • Video review and coach feedback
  • Ongoing communication inside the Player Portal
  • Support between sessions when questions come up

Build habits that carry over

  • Accountability through consistent daily work
  • Progress tracking and training history
  • Development that extends beyond the facility

Members also get early access to camps, pop-up trainings, live BP, and new group openings — the in-person moments that show up throughout the year.

$159/month

The days between sessions are where players learn how to truly develop.

Unlock my player portal

Add weekly in-person coaching

For athletes ready for weekly in-person reps — two coaching environments, matched by Nick based on fit.

4:1
Includes full Player Portal + daily programming

Small Group Training (4:1)

$325/month

A small group that moves, competes, and gets better together.

Who this is for

  • Players who enjoy training alongside others
  • Players who pick things up by watching and competing
  • Players who want structure, but don't need every rep to be one-on-one

What it looks like

  • One group session each week
  • Reps come consistently, with coaching in between
  • A mix of individual focus and group energy
2:1
Includes full Player Portal + daily programming

Semi-Private Training (2:1)

$450/month

More time, more reps, and more attention to detail.

Who this is for

  • Players who want more individual attention
  • Players working through specific adjustments
  • Players ready for a steady weekly rhythm

What it looks like

  • Same weekly slot with the same partner
  • More hands-on coaching and direct feedback
  • Time to work through things without feeling rushed